Locking Mechanism For Use With a Foldable Rollator

Almost all rollators have some sort of locking mechanism or latch to prevent the rollators from being rolled out during storage. This is crucial for safety and avoids a dangerous situation during transport.

The lock is usually situated in the middle of the frame. It could be a lever or button. It's important to know how to make use of this feature.

Another major characteristic of a rolling machine is the brakes, which are normally situated on the handles or the crossbar. There are a variety of brake systems, including cable loop and push-down. The push-down brakes require the user to apply downward pressure on the spring-loaded frame in order to stop the walker from sliding. This kind of system is not suitable for smaller users who might struggle to engage the breaks or heavier users who could unintentionally activate the brakes.

The cable loop brake is similar to the brakes on a bicycle. The cable loop brake system is activated by simultaneously squeezing the handlebars in both hands. This type of brake system is suited to individuals who have limited hand function, and it provides more control than brakes that are pushed down.
